Abstract

The provision of ubiquitous services in Mobile Ad-hoc Networks (MANETs) is a great challenge, considering the bandwidth, mobility, and computational-resources constraints exhibited by these networks. Incorporation of modern delay-sensitive applications has made the task even harder. The traditional Quality of Service (QoS) provisioning techniques are not applicable on MANETs because such networks are highly dynamic in nature. The available QoS provisioning algorithms are either not efficient or are embedded into routing protocols adding a high computation and communication load. In this paper, we propose a Network State Adaptive QoS provision algorithm (NETSAQ) that works with many underlying routing protocol. It ensures the QoS provisioning according to the high level policy. NETSAQ is simple to implement yet minimizes the degradation of the best effort traffic at a considerable level. Our simulation results show that NETSAQ adapts well in MANET environments where multiple services are contending for limited resources.
